Lead processing - Lead processing - Mining and concentrating: Once the ore is removed from veins (narrow channels) or lodes (roughly spherical deposits) in the Earth, usually at depths of about 60 metres, the ore is treated at concentrating mills. Here the ore is finely crushed, sometimes to particle diameters of less than 0.1 millimetre (0.004 inch), and then treated by one of several mineral ...

Lead smelting: The crushed and ground ore, containing 38% lead, is concentrated by differential flotation. It is then pelletized with limestone, silica sand, and iron ore.
Copper smelting slag is produced from copper pyrometallurgy (both smelting and converting stages), usually grading at 0.3-3%. The slag may also contains lead zinc minerals like galena, sphalerite. Copper mainly dwells in the slag in the form of bornite, chalcocite, chalcopyrite, and metallic copper.

Plants for the production of lead are generally referred to as lead smelters.Primary lead production begins with sintering.Concentrated lead ore is fed into a sintering machine with iron, silica, limestone fluxes, coke, soda ash, pyrite, zinc, caustics or pollution control particulates. Smelting uses suitable reducing substances that will combine with those oxidizing elements to free the metal.

Smelting is a process of applying heat to ore in order to extract a base metal.It is a form of extractive metallurgy.It is used to extract many metals from their ores, including silver, iron, copper, and other base metals.Smelting uses heat and a chemical reducing agent to decompose the ore, driving off other elements as gases or slag and leaving the metal base behind.

Lead fumes may be emitted at the lead or slag tapping plugs during removal of the tapping plug or while lancing the tapping plug. Emissions may occur while pouring lead or slag at the tapping launder, mold, ladle, or refining kettle. Lead dust may become airborne due to disturbance of settled dust in the smelting

At extendea smelting times, some lead was oxidized to the slag phase and thus the lead recovery marginally decreased. The effect of smelting temperature on lead recovery is shown in Fig. 16. The smelting time was maintained at 30 min. Smelting temperatures of over 1173 K were required to achieve good slag-metal separation.
Granulated lead smelter slag is an effective supplementary cementitious material. • Particle size has significate influence on compressive strength. • Mechanical properties of concrete with slag are similar to those with fly ash. • The addition of lead smelter slag results in a decrease of the drying shrinkage.

A major and primary Lead mineral is galena (PbS) which comprises of 86.6% of lead. In order to smelt this mineral, a blast furnace is needed to be used. A blast furnace is an enormous oven which is used to accomplish the smelting processes. Apr 09, 2018 Slag Pit (deep) Slag Bowl (shallow) No slag pit. The type of basal pit can tell us something about the smelting method used. Thererefore A deep slag pit (think at least as deep as it is wide – i.e. 30+ cm) indicates no slag tapping and a considerable amount of ore being smelted per run. This is your classic ‘Slag-Pit Furnace’.

4.1.2.1 Production of Metallic Lead - Smelting The next stage is to convert the lead ore into lead metal. The general name given to this type of process is smelting. Historical accounts of lead smelting are described in the Annex - Historical production and uses of lead. Old lead workings are a current source of lead
Soda ash smelting slag from recycling lead acid battery residues can result in serious environmental effects. The slag is very reactive and can cause fires through ‘overheating’ especially of large pieces of slag; it is also highly alkaline and therefore corrosive.
The Lead is then cooled in stages which cause the lighter impurities (dross) to rise to the surface where they can be removed. The molten Lead bullion is then refined by additional smelting with air being passed over the Lead to form a slag layer containing any remaining impurities and producing 99.9% pure Lead. A method of making cement from base metal smelter slag produced by a nickel, copper, lead or zinc smelter, includes crushing the slag with a source of calcium sulphate to a size of less than about 1/4 inch and heating the mixture to produce a cement, and grinding the cement to a size in the range of from about -250 to about 425 mesh.

Lead for recycling may be in the form of scrap metal (roofing sheet, for example), or compounds of lead, such as the pastes from lead-acid batteries. Clean metallic lead can be melted and refined directly, but compounds and lead alloys require smelting, using processes similar to those used with lead ores.

plants have been constructed to date for recycling lead batteries, producing a low-antimony soft lead plus a lead antimony slag from which a lead antimony alloy and a low-lead silicate slag can be produced. Sulphur capture has been achieved either by the use of a lime scrubber or by paste desulphurisation prior to smelting.
Slag is an inevitable waste from secondary lead smelting process. Depending on added flux during the battery paste smelting, various types of slag can be obtained: silica slag, calcium slag and sodium slag (produced by adding Na2CO3 as flux).
